Job Summary

The CNC Machinist produces machined parts by setting up and operating a computer numerical control (CNC) machine, maintaining quality and safety standards, keeping records and maintaining equipment and supplies.

Essential Functions
  • Understand work orders, blueprints, manufacturing orders, and machining parameters
  • Validate material used
  • Maintain specifications; Troubleshoot, detect malfunctions and take appropriate actions
  • Know when to replace worn tools
  • Listen to machining operation in order to detect sounds such as those made by dull cutting tools or excessive vibration and compensate for problems
  • Measure dimensions of finished work pieces to ensure conformance to specifications using precision measuring instruments, templates, fixtures and knowledge of GDT standards
  • Maintain continuity among shifts by documenting and communicating actions taken thus far as well as any necessary further steps
  • Any other task assigned by supervisor or management

Working Conditions

Working conditions are normal for a manufacturing environment.

Manufacturing operations may require the use of safety equipment to include but not limited to: eye safety glasses, gowning, masks, hearing protectors, heel/wrist straps and any other required PPE.

May be exposed to unusual environmental conditions such as loud noises, cold temperatures, confined spaces, dust or fumes.

Flexible and willing to work overtime if necessary.

Standing: 100% *percentage is approximate and may vary depending on work task.

Sitting: 0% *percentage is approximate and may vary depending on work task.

Lifting (in pounds): up to 30 pounds.

Pushing (in pounds): up to 50 pounds.

Mental/Visual: use of microscope, computer and blueprints.

Workspace: clean bench, measuring table.
